Next thing i wanted to try is vfs_shadow_copy2 (with LVM snapshots: 
https://wiki.samba.org/index.php/Rotating_LVM_snapshots_for_shadow_copy). 
But as soon as i enable "vfs objects = shadow_copy2" for a share i can't 
administer file permissions ("Security") via Windows (as "Domain Admin") 
anymore. This happens even without any snapshots (it's the same when 
there are snapshots).
Why?

I tried disabling SELinux, no avail. I'm attaching some "log level = 9" 
logs and hope someone can enlighten me.
